Digital Signal Processing

For full-range passive systems, the internal crossover/equalizer network sends low frequencies to the woofer and high
frequencies to the compression-driver/waveguide combination. In addition, the network tailors the frequency response and
levels of each individual driver so the overall frequency response of the loudspeaker is essentially flat over its design operating
range.

Once the EVU systems is installed in its venue, a DSP (Digital Signal Processor) is used to adjust the in-room frequency
response, based on the specifics of the venue. In addition, the DSP should be used to provide the high-pass filters
recommended to protect the EVU system against overdrive at frequencies below their operating range, failure to do so could
damage the low-frequency drivers if fed high-level signals below the system's operating range. The recommended high-pass
filter frequencies for infrasonic protection of EVU system is shown in Table 3.
Recommended High-Pass Filter Frequencies
TABLE 3.
Model Number
EVU-1062/95
EVU-1082/95
EVU-2062/95
EVU-2082/95
Recommended High-Pass
Frequency (minimum)
90Hz; 24dB Per Octave
90Hz; 24dB Per Octave
90Hz; 24dB Per Octave
90Hz; 24dB Per Octave
